RegularExpressionValidator.ValidationExpression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Получает или задает регулярное выражение, назначенное в качестве условия проверки. Значение по умолчанию — пустая строка. Этот API устарел. Сведения о разработке ASP.NET мобильных приложений см. в статье Мобильные приложения & сайты с ASP.NET.
public:
property System::String ^ ValidationExpression { System::String ^ get(); void set(System::String ^ value); };
[System.ComponentModel.Bindable(true)]
public string ValidationExpression { get; set; }
[<System.ComponentModel.Bindable(true)>]
member this.ValidationExpression : string with get, set
Public Property ValidationExpression As String
Значение свойства
Регулярное выражение, назначенное в качестве условия проверки.
Объект RegularExpressionValidator не выполняет проверки пустой строки. Чтобы проверить пустую строку, используйте вместе элементы управления RequiredFieldValidator и RegularExpressionValidator.
- Атрибуты
Исключения
Назначенное регулярное выражение не было сформировано должным образом.
Комментарии
В следующей таблице приведены примеры выражений проверки.
Тип проверки | Выражение проверки |
---|---|
электронная почта; | \w+([-+.] \w+)*@\w+([-.] \w+)*\.\w+([-.] \w+) |
Номер телефона | ((\(\d{3}\) ?)|(\d{3}-))?\d{3}-\d{4} |
URL-адрес | http://([\w-]+\.) +[\w-]+(/[\w-./?%&=]*)? |